TodofukenSelect.phpアップデート(0.2.0)

TodofukenSelect.phpをアップデートしました。バージョン0.2.0です。
GAddress Finder
のサンプル用に使おうとして、気になるとこを直したのです。
このTodofukenSelect.phpって、あまり使わないけどたまに便利だったりします。お手軽で。

主な変更点は、

  • 数字2桁のコードを廃止して、formで送信される値を都道府県名にした
  • TodofukenSelect::isTodofuken()を追加し、都道府県名として正しいかチェックできるようにした

数字2桁のコードは、使っていて不要だと思ったので削除しました。
DBに登録するにしても、下手にコード化するより都道府県名をそのまま登録したほうが視認性が高いと思うのです。
将来的な都道府県体系の変更時のデータのコンバートまで考慮したとしても、コードより都道府県名が使いづらいというケースはないでしょう。

 

DB不要、JavaScriptのみで郵便番号から住所を取得できるツールを作った

GAddress Finderを作りました。

郵便番号を元に、Google日本語入力APIからJSONPで住所データを取得します。
そしてそれをいい感じに住所入力フォームにセットします。
さらに、郵便番号にハイフンが入っていない場合はハイフンを入れて、数字やハイフンが全角の場合は半角にします。

これを応用すれば、郵便番号だけでなくいろんなものを変換したりリストアップしたり色々なことができそうで夢が広がりますが、とりあえず何も思いつきません。(時間があったら調べようかな?)